Transaction 23e2bf3cfca84998e6d75f20c8a5514e3a4713ef55185a3acba10e25e6378d7d

1 Input
2 Outputs
  • 23e2bf3cfca84998e6d75f20c8a5514e3a4713ef55185a3acba10e25e6378d7d:0
  • value  37777475
    address  1Lup1NcvjASYmPL1SA3tHzvgci4SKayxEV
  • 23e2bf3cfca84998e6d75f20c8a5514e3a4713ef55185a3acba10e25e6378d7d:1
  • value  14374664
    address  1KvpTvQUHZ85hdjcrp1ony7kvcbriUTUa